Subject: Partner SFTP drop — new owner

Hi,

As you review the pending changes to the Harborline ingest scripts, note that ownership of the partner SFTP drop is changing at the end of the month. This includes key rotation, the nightly pull job, and the quarantine folder for malformed files. Review comments on the retry logic should still go through the normal PR flow, but questions about drop-folder conventions or partner onboarding now go to the new owner. The incoming owner is listed below.

signatory, tagaf-bahaf: Praael Fenmir Rusok

Subject: Quickstore 4.2 — bloom filter now fronts the KV layer

Plugin authors: starting with this release, Quickstore places a bloom filter ahead of the key-value store. Negative lookups return faster; false positives fall through safely. No API changes are required on your side. Verify your plugin against the staging build referenced below.

session token of fahif-tadup = htk3_9c7

Runbook bit — Bouncehound release

Heads up, support folks: this release changes how Bouncehound classifies soft vs hard bounces, so expect a few tickets about suppression lists looking different. Don't manually unsuppress anyone until the backfill job finishes (watch the dashboard). To push the release to the mail workers, the deployer needs to authenticate — use the deploy key below.

signing key of yajop-hahog = bky4_eXoX

# Break-Glass: Harrowgate Partner SFTP Drop

For the weekly eng sync: if the Harrowgate partner SFTP drop rejects all service accounts, use break-glass access only after confirming the outage with the duty lead. Document the window, file sizes moved, and re-lock afterward. The emergency recovery passphrase is recorded immediately below this line.

unlock words, yawip-yadug: briix-holix-pelox